Petaluma, California (September 25, 2020) – The Sonoma County Sheriff-Coroner’s Office has released the name of the driver who was killed Wednesday evening in a traffic accident at an intersection in Petaluma.

Rene Alvarez Deleon, 38, of San Rafael, died in the crash that happened just before 6:32 p.m. Wednesday, September 23, at the intersection of Lakeville Highway and South McDowell Boulevard.

According to the police, a white Toyota sedan, driven by Deleon, was heading westbound on South McDowell Boulevard when, for an unknown reason, it collided with a black Nissan pickup truck that was traveling northbound on Lakeville Highway.

Following the impact, the two vehicles came to a stop in a small grove of trees.

Deleon was pronounced dead at the scene.  The Nissan driver suffered major injuries and was transported to a local hospital for treatment.
